Package: thttpd
Version: 2.23beta1-2.3
Severity: normal
When doing a recursive download from THTTPD over loopback I had the
problem that the server was complaining about an internal error and
failing to server pages.
It turns out this is because it had used up all the processes it was
allowed to use up.
| tomg@geek:~$ ps auwwx | grep thttpd | grep -c defunct
| 626
THTTPD seems to *eventually* clean up these zombie processes, but it's
not soon enough.
